North Carolina Helmet Laws & Recommended Safety Gear
North Carolina requires all motorcycle riders and passengers to wear a helmet. Following the law can reduce the risk of head trauma and help prevent insurers from raising helmet-related arguments to dispute a claim. Helmets should meet federal safety standards and include a DOT certification.
The Motorcycle Safety Foundation also recommends:
- Face shield or eye protection
- Gloves for grip and control
- Long-sleeved jacket and long pants made with abrasion-resistant material
- Over-ankle boots with solid traction
- Bright or reflective clothing to improve visibility
What to Do After a Motorcycle Accident in Asheville
The steps taken after a crash can protect your health and strengthen your case.
- Get medical care right away, even if symptoms feel minor
- Call law enforcement and request a crash report
- Take photos of the scene, vehicles, road conditions, and visible injuries
- Collect witness names and contact information
- Avoid discussing fault at the scene
- Keep records of treatment, expenses, missed work, and motorcycle repairs
If the crash involved a hit and run, write down everything you can about the vehicle and direction of travel, and report it immediately. An Asheville motorcycle accident lawyer can handle insurance communications and protect important deadlines while you focus on recovery.
What Compensation Can Cover After a Motorcycle Accident
A motorcycle accident can create costs that go far beyond the first hospital visit.
A claim may seek compensation for both immediate losses and long-term needs, including:
- Emergency care, hospital bills, surgery, and follow-up treatment
- Physical therapy, rehabilitation, prescriptions, and medical equipment
- Future medical care for ongoing symptoms or permanent injuries
- Lost wages and reduced earning capacity
- Pain and suffering and loss of enjoyment of life
- Motorcycle repair or replacement and related property damage
The value of a claim often depends on strong documentation and clear evidence of fault and future impact.
